XML 31 R21.htm IDEA: XBRL DOCUMENT v3.24.2.u1
Goodwill and Intangible Assets (Notes)
6 Months Ended
Jun. 30, 2024
Goodwill and Intangible Assets Disclosure [Abstract]  
Goodwill and Intangible Assets Disclosure [Text Block] Goodwill and Intangible Assets, Net
Goodwill

    The following table presents the changes in the carrying amount of our goodwill (in thousands):
Total
Balance as of January 1, 2024
$1,472,446 
Currency translation(21,511)
Balance as of June 30, 2024
$1,450,935 

Intangible Assets, Net

    Intangible assets, carried at cost less accumulated amortization and amortized on a straight-line basis, were as follows (in thousands):
 Weighted-Average Amortization Life in YearsJune 30, 2024
 CostAccumulated
Amortization
Net
Patents10$34,840 $21,747 $13,093 
Customer contracts129,835 6,849 2,986 
Non-contractual customer relationships8550,145 203,725 346,420 
Trademarks15,425 5,425 — 
Trade name1518,248 7,762 10,486 
Developed technology10587,153 197,000 390,153 
Non-compete39,100 8,550 550 
Total amortized intangible assets $1,214,746 $451,058 $763,688 
Internally developed software(1)
$42,106 $42,106 
Total intangible assets$1,256,852 $451,058 $805,794 
______________________________
(1) Internally developed software will be amortized when the projects are complete and the assets are ready for their intended use.

 Weighted-Average Amortization Life in Years
December 31, 2023
 CostAccumulated
Amortization
Net
Patents10$33,261 $20,637 $12,624 
Customer contracts1210,018 6,755 3,263 
Non-contractual customer relationships8554,982 171,279 383,703 
Trademarks15,425 5,425 — 
Trade name1518,251 7,162 11,089 
Developed technology10587,852 167,913 419,939 
Non-compete39,100 7,450 1,650 
Total amortized intangible assets $1,218,889 $386,621 $832,268 
Internally developed software(1)
$38,320 $38,320 
Total intangible assets$1,257,209 $386,621 $870,588 
______________________________
(1) Internally developed software will be amortized when the projects are complete and the assets are ready for their intended use.

Intangible assets with definite lives are amortized on a straight-line basis over their estimated useful lives. Intangible asset amortization expense was $33.1 million and $66.2 million during the three and six months ended June 30, 2024, respectively, and $33.1 million and $65.4 million during the three and six months ended June 30, 2023, respectively.

As of June 30, 2024 estimated annual amortization for our intangible assets for each of the next five years and thereafter is approximately (in thousands):
Remainder of 2024$65,794 
2025124,722 
2026123,940 
2027113,862 
2028113,264 
2029110,181 
Thereafter111,925 
Total$763,688